package com.education.vidyarthi.online.Daoimpl;
import java.util.List;
import org.hibernate.SessionFactory;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Repository;
import com.education.vidyarthi.online.Dao.LanguageDao;
import com.education.vidyarthi.online.model.Language;
@Repository("languageDao")
public class LanguageDaoImpl implements LanguageDao {
@Autowired
private SessionFactory sessionFactory;
public List<com.education.vidyarthi.online.model.Language> listLanguages() {
return (List<Language>) sessionFactory.getCurrentSession()
.createCriteria(Language.class).list();
}
public List<Language> getLanguageByLanguageId(
Long languageId) {
return sessionFactory.getCurrentSession().createQuery(
"from Language where languageId=:languageId").setParameter(
"languageId", languageId).list();
}
}
import java.util.List;
import org.hibernate.SessionFactory;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Repository;
import com.education.vidyarthi.online.Dao.LanguageDao;
import com.education.vidyarthi.online.model.Language;
@Repository("languageDao")
public class LanguageDaoImpl implements LanguageDao {
@Autowired
private SessionFactory sessionFactory;
public List<com.education.vidyarthi.online.model.Language> listLanguages() {
return (List<Language>) sessionFactory.getCurrentSession()
.createCriteria(Language.class).list();
}
public List<Language> getLanguageByLanguageId(
Long languageId) {
return sessionFactory.getCurrentSession().createQuery(
"from Language where languageId=:languageId").setParameter(
"languageId", languageId).list();
}
}
0 comments:
Post a Comment